## Deploying the Gatewick Proctor Queue

Deploys are pretty painless: push to main, wait for the pipeline, then watch the queue drain dashboard for five minutes. If candidates pile up mid-exam, roll back first and ask questions later — the queue replays safely. Everything the workers care about lives in one config block, shown here for reference.

settings of bafof-yagef:
JOROX_PIN=8740
JOROX_TENANT=pelox
JOROX_METRICS_HOST=metrics.jorox.qorvelworks.internal
JOROX_SEAL=seal_c78f63c1
JOROX_STANDBY_TEAM=norax

Finance Review Summary — Loyalty Programme Overhaul

The redesigned Kestrel Rewards scheme reduced redemption liability by 14% over the half-year while member activity at Varnholt stores rose modestly. Accrual costs remain within the envelope approved in March. Breakage assumptions were revised downward on auditor advice. The confidential outline of next-phase commercial plans follows below.

board note of bawep-tajef: Queniusek Systems plans to raise the Quenvan list price by 53.1 percent in March. The pricing group signed off on a budget of $176.4 million for Project Drueth. The renewal with Casionix Partners closes at $142.5 million a year, 8.3 percent below the last contract. Project Fraax slips by six weeks because of the tooling delay.

Minutes — Management Meeting

Prepared for the incoming director. Topic: possible acquisition of Greyfen Analytics. Due diligence 70% complete. Valuation gap remains; Greyfen seeks a premium. Integration risks flagged by Ops. Decision deferred to next month. Talla Nyberg leads negotiations. Our walk-away position is stated below.

board note of fawig-kagup: Only 48 of the 435 pilot accounts renewed Rusion, so a churn review is set for September 12. Fenwynox Logistics is in early talks to buy Sorielek Systems for about $117.8 million.

Starting this release, user-supplied formulas no longer evaluate in the main worker process. Each formula runs in an isolated interpreter with a hard CPU and memory ceiling, no filesystem access, and a whitelist of built-in functions. Migrate tenants by enabling the sandbox flag per workspace, then re-run the validation sweep to catch formulas that relied on removed globals. Expect a small latency increase per evaluation; batching mitigates most of it. The sandbox ships with the following configuration.

service settings:
ulaael:
  log_level: warn
  metrics_host: metrics.ulaael.tolvaqsys.internal
  pin: 7801
  pool_size: 16